Performance-Based Scholarships: Emerging Findings from a National Demonstration - 0 views

  •  
    Summarizes preliminary results from performance-based scholarship programs in Ohio, New York, and New Mexico, in addition to the original results in Louisiana. The results show modest but positive effects on markers of academic progress, including increases in credits earned. (MDRC, May 2012)
